Understanding How Hormonal Imbalances Drive Stubborn Weight Gain

I've worked with thousands of women in their late 40s and early 50s who feel defeated by hormonal imbalances. Conditions like PCOS create insulin resistance, where your cells stop responding properly to insulin, causing your body to store fat—especially around the midsection. Studies show women with PCOS often have 30-50% higher insulin levels, making traditional calorie-cutting diets fail dramatically. Add perimenopause, and declining estrogen further slows metabolism by up to 8% per decade while increasing inflammation that worsens joint pain.

The real frustration? Conflicting nutrition advice fueled by pharmaceutical and diet-industry agendas that ignore these biological realities. Low-fat, high-carb recommendations can spike blood sugar, worsening diabetes and blood pressure you may already manage. This is precisely when biases become "law"—and why we must speak up.

Why Most Diets Fail Women with PCOS and Joint Limitations

Standard programs demand hours at the gym or complex meal plans that middle-income families can't sustain. With joint pain making exercise feel impossible, many women avoid movement entirely, leading to further muscle loss. My approach in The CFP Weight Loss Method starts with gentle, joint-friendly movement: 10-minute daily walks that build to resistance-band strength sessions proven to improve insulin sensitivity by 25% without aggravating knees or hips.

Nutrition focuses on blood-sugar stabilizing meals requiring minimal prep: eggs with spinach for breakfast, grilled chicken with broccoli and olive oil for lunch. These simple swaps reduce cravings within 7-10 days while supporting hormonal health. Insurance rarely covers specialized programs, so we emphasize affordable, sustainable changes over expensive supplements or medications with side effects.

Actionable Strategies to Reclaim Your Health Despite Hormonal Challenges

Begin by tracking symptoms—not just scale weight. Many clients see blood pressure drop 10-15 points and A1C improve within 8 weeks when they prioritize protein (aim for 25-30g per meal) and fiber while limiting processed carbs to under 100g daily. For PCOS weight loss, incorporate spearmint tea and magnesium-rich foods like pumpkin seeds to naturally balance androgens.

Address embarrassment by connecting with supportive communities rather than suffering silently. Small accountability steps, like prepping vegetables on Sunday, prevent the overwhelm of conflicting advice. Remember, hormonal changes don't sentence you to permanent weight gain. With the right protocol, women in our program lose 1-2 pounds weekly while reducing joint discomfort through anti-inflammatory eating.

Breaking Free from Biased Agendas and Building Sustainable Success

The medical system often defaults to "eat less, move more" without addressing root causes like cortisol spikes from chronic stress or sleep disruption common in this age group. Speaking up means asking your doctor for full hormone panels including fasting insulin, not just TSH. In The CFP Weight Loss Method, we teach advocacy: request metformin alternatives like myo-inositol if appropriate, or explore thyroid optimization when energy remains low.

Consistency beats perfection. Start with one change today—perhaps swapping sugary drinks for infused water—to build momentum. Thousands have reversed their "failed every diet" pattern by rejecting one-size-fits-all advice and embracing personalized hormonal support. Your body isn't broken; it simply needs the correct keys to unlock healthy weight management.
